Ubuntu 17.04 nie wymaga już hasła po wyjściu z trybu uśpienia


8

Z jakiegoś powodu, kiedy otwieram laptopa i budzi się, nie pyta mnie już o hasło użytkownika (kiedyś). Jak rozwiązać ten problem i włączyć żądanie hasła po przebudzeniu?


Coś w syslog lub dmesg podczas budzenia? Czy możesz go wkleić tutaj lub połączyć z pastebin?
Robert Riedl

Zdarza mi się to sporadycznie 16.04. Czy to wciąż dzieje się dla ciebie, czy czasem?
Chai T. Rex

Wspominasz o zamykaniu i otwieraniu pokrywy dla działań zawieszenia / wznowienia. Co się stanie, gdy wybierzesz Zawieś z menu i użyjesz przycisku zasilania, aby wznowić?
WinEunuuchs2Unix

Takie samo zachowanie. Budzi się i wracam do pulpitu.
ffxsam

Odpowiedzi:


1

Krok 1: Czy zainstalowany jest wygaszacz ekranu?

Hasło przy wznawianiu zawieszenia jest oparte na ekranie blokady ekranu, a ekran blokady opiera się na wygaszaczu ekranu. Aby sprawdzić wygaszacz ekranu, użyj apt list --installed | grep saver:

WARNING: apt does not have a stable CLI interface. Use with caution in scripts.

gnome-screensaver/xenial,now 3.6.1-7ubuntu4 amd64 [installed]

Jeśli powyżej nie widać wygaszacza ekranu, użyj:

sudo apt install gnome-screensaver

Krok 2 jest włączony ekran blokady?

Blokada ekranu musi być włączona:

gsettings get org.gnome.desktop.lockdown disable-lock-screen
false

Jeśli wynik jest następujący, trueużyj:

gsettings set org.gnome.desktop.lockdown disable-lock-screen false

Tak, gnome-screensaverjest zainstalowany.
ffxsam

@ffxsam Czy ekran blokady ręcznej działa i pyta o hasło?
WinEunuuchs2Unix

Aha! Teraz jesteśmy na czymś. Super + L nie blokuje systemu tak, jak powinien. Ten skrót klawiszowy jest poprawnie zdefiniowany.
ffxsam

Spróbujgsettings get org.gnome.desktop.lockdown disable-lock-screen
WinEunuuchs2Unix

Właśnie zauważyłem, że mam ten sam problem: askubuntu.com/questions/986182/...
ffxsam

2

Sprawdź wartość

gsettings get org.gnome.desktop.screensaver ubuntu-lock-on-suspend

jeśli wróci z „false”, ustaw to na „true” z

gsettings set org.gnome.desktop.screensaver ubuntu-lock-on-suspend true

Możesz to również zrobić za pomocą GUI, używając dconf-editor- przejdź do „org-> gnome-> desktop-> wygaszacz ekranu-> ubuntu-lock-on-suspend”


Rezultatem jest true. Bardzo dziwny.
ffxsam,

1

Jest tak, ponieważ automatyczne zawieszanie może być wyłączone.

Włączenie go rozwiąże problem. Oto jak:

  1. Przejdź do Ustawienia> Moc.

  1. Kliknij opcję „Automatyczne zawieszenie”.

  1. Włącz opcję „W stanie bezczynności”.

Gotowy. Daj mi znać, czy to rozwiąże problem, czy nie.


Nie, nie było wyłączone. Jest ustawiony na „przy zasilaniu bateryjnym”, opóźnienie 15 minut. Nie ma opcji „w stanie bezczynności”. (Jestem na Ubuntu 17.10)
ffxsam

Myślę, że moja instalacja musiała się jakoś zepsuć.
ffxsam

GNOME czy Unity?
v_ag

GNOM. ........
ffxsam

0

Sprawdź dzienniki zawieszenia na /var/log/pm-suspend.log

sudo nano /var/log/pm-suspend.log

Możliwe rozwiązanie 1:

Edytuj plik „/etc/systemd/logind.conf”

sudo nano /etc/systemd/logind.conf

Usunięto # komentarz na początku wiersza „HandleLidSwitchDocked = ignore” i zmieniono wartość na:

HandleLidSwitchDocked=suspend

Uruchom ponownie demona systemd za pomocą tego polecenia:

sudo restart systemd-logind

lub od 15.04:

sudo service systemd-logind restart

Nie ma takiego szczęścia. I nie ma /var/log/pm-suspend.log. Problem niekoniecznie oznacza zamknięcie pokrywy. Zawieszenie ogólnie nie wymaga hasła podczas budzenia.
ffxsam
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.